About The Job
Responsible for the daily creative execution of projects including new design, reviewing projects, incorporating comments, and ensuring consistency across campaign materials
Ensures projects are on time and meet the highest standards of design excellence
Understands brand, disease state, and competitive products
Understands brand strategies and how the assets created help solve client’s business challenges
Present creative work and ideas with copy partner to clients, referencing brand strategies
Work on campaign execution, attend photo/video shoots (as opportunities present); engage with photographers, CGI artists, videographers, and illustrators with supervisor support
Works collaboratively with all cross‑functional team members including Studio, Copy, Project Management, and Account Management
Support new business efforts and/or conceptual work
Help to manage Studio Artists, Graphic Designers, freelancers, and more junior team members
About You
3-4 years of pharmaceutical art direction experience in a fast‑paced agency setting
Recent experience working on a pharmaceutical brand / familiarity with scientific information related to pharmaceutical advertising
Understanding of the agency process and ability to ask direct and relevant questions pertaining to timing, content, or creative direction
Proficient in Adobe InDesign
A compelling portfolio included with your application (can be website, file sharing link or PDF attachment)
Ability to manage projects with little supervision
Proven ability to present approved content to clients
Excellent attention to detail
Motivated to seek/gain additional creative opportunities and work on new business pitches
Proactive about finding inspiration and researching new creative ideas for keeping things fresh
Autonomous, yet you know when and how to raise questions or issues to your manager
